Well, the story sets in 1899 where a 600 years old vampire named Chapel who was a Templar Knight (i think) met Pru, a woman who is searching for the Holy Grail, or Unholy Grail. Either one works for her because she's convinced that the Grail can help cure her cancer. Chapel became a vampire after he and his Brotherhoods, known by the church as the Brotherhood of Blood, drank from the Unholy Grail and convinced that it was a curse and a punishment. Pru thought it was a blessing. So throughout the entire course of the story, Chapel fought his desire to change Pru to become like him, knowing that it will save her life and make her immortal.
